Original drivers were built for Windows XP, Windows Vista, or Windows 7. Patched drivers modify the configuration files ( .inf ) to force newer operating systems to recognize and initialize the legacy hardware.

A cheap, modern USB 2.0 or USB 3.0 to RJ45 adapter bypasses the motherboard's built-in NIC entirely. These devices use modern, automatically recognized chipsets.
